Women-Focused Group
In early and sustained recovery, women often need to address and receive emotional support for a variety of concerns. These are concerns that can be especially profound and transformative to a woman's self-esteem, trauma history, relationships, sexuality, ethnicity, and effects of the dominant culture-both pre-recovery and after recovery begins. Every aspect of a woman's life can change as a result of choosing a life of recovery. We are here to support the needs of women in recovery, to build healthy connections and friendships, and to engage in a therapeutic, open, safe, and supportive environment.
